Can't they make it like Microsoft Wind... moreA CD wouldn't be of much use for a smartphone...
But sure, in concept things should have been designed with upgradability in mind.
The thing is, although the hardware is capable of upgrading it's OS, Android itself isn't that well thought-out to just deploy a generic update that easily and effortlessly accommodates most of the several different hardware configurations out there.
The end result is you always need a specific ROM tailored exclusively for your device. This takes lots of time and costs lots of money.
So what we end up seeing is manufacturers just don't upgrade most of their devices, they only take the one time cost of developing the first ROM, iron out the bugs that ROM may have in the first year of the device and (from there after) the device is "dead" for all OS updates purposes.
This is especially bad when there are pending security updates at kernel level.
